Account verification and identity checks

Two principal varieties exist: pseudo-random number generators and hardware-based true random number engines. Pseudo-random engines employ mathematical equations initialized with unpredictable inputs to produce number series. Hardware solutions capture entropy from tangible occurrences such as electronic interference, producing truly uncertain outputs.

Rising advancements in online gaming sites

Enhanced reality overlays computerized components onto tangible surroundings through mobile phone sensors or specialized devices. Users can cast virtual slot devices onto physical areas or display card games on physical areas. These combined sessions merge electronic accessibility with physical involvement.

Blockchain-based verifiably honest gaming permits participants to verify result validity personally. Cryptographic approaches permit users to establish that conclusions were calculated legitimately without operator manipulation. Decentralized structures abolish centralized controllers, dispersing control across infrastructure participants.
